At 1:24 AM on July 15, 2023, Officer Andrew Purk with the Bellefontaine Police Department responded to a report of a driver with a suspended license who was driving. He made contact with the suspect, 26-year-old Jade Irwin, in a parking lot near the intersection of N Detroit Street and W Sandusky Avenue. After he made contact with Jade, Officer Purk noticed signs of impairment. He also decided to search the vehicle, and noticed that she was in possession of prohibited items. Based on his suspicion of impairment, he offered Jade an opportunity to complete field sobriety exercises.

The first field sobriety exercise involved the Horizontal Gaze Nystagmus (HGN) test, and Officer Purk observed the lack of smooth pursuit, distinct and sustained nystagmus at maximum deviation, and the onset of nystagmus prior to 45 degrees. He did not observe any vertical gaze nystagmus (VGN). Afterwards, he asked her to perform the Walk and Turn and One Leg Stand tests, but she claimed that she was unable to complete it. The second test that she agreed to complete was the modified Romberg balance test, where she was asked to estimate the passage of 30 seconds. Jade said “done” instead of “stop” after 27 seconds. The third test was the recitation of the alphabet from “C” to “N,” which she recited slowly in the correct sequence. The final test involved counting backwards from 67 to 49, but she stopped at 50 before asking when she was supposed to stop.

Based on the witness report, her indicators of impairment, her inability to complete the field sobriety tests, and her being in possession of illegal items, Jade was placed under arrest for operating a vehicle impaired (OVI) and transported to the Logan County Jail for further processing. At the jail, Officer Purk read her BMV form 2255. Jade ultimately refused to provide a urine sample. She was issued the following charges: Possession of Controlled Substance, Operating a Vehicle Impaired (OVI), and Driving Under Suspension (ALS Refusal)
